Morgan Stanley analyst Alex Straton raised the firm’s price target on Urban Outfitters to $39 from $36 and keeps an Equal Weight rating on the shares after having hosted meetings with management on day two of the 2024 ICR conference. The company’s fiscal Q4 sales and profitability guidance raise “surpassed buyside expectations for more moderate upside,” but the firm worries that the flagship banner will struggle to inflect until mid-to-late 2024 “at the earliest,” the analyst tells investors.
